AI in Space: How Machine Learning is Aiding Space Exploration

Hey there! As a loyal space enthusiast, I couldn’t resist but write about how AI is revolutionizing space exploration. Machine learning has been a game-changer in almost every industry, and space exploration is no exception. Let’s dive into how AI is aiding space exploration.

Firstly, AI is helping us to better understand and predict space weather. Space weather can impact spacecraft and astronauts, and predicting it accurately is crucial. Machine learning algorithms can analyze large amounts of data and identify patterns, which helps us to predict space weather with greater accuracy and speed.

Secondly, AI is helping us to find and identify exoplanets. Exoplanets are planets outside of our solar system, and they’re incredibly challenging to find. With AI, we can analyze large amounts of data from telescopes and identify potential exoplanets. Machine learning algorithms can also help us to identify the characteristics of these planets, such as their size, composition, and distance from their star.

Thirdly, AI is helping us to navigate and control spacecraft. Spacecraft travel huge distances, and they need to be controlled with precision. The use of AI in spacecraft navigation means that we can make adjustments quickly and accurately, reducing the risk of accidents and improving the chances of mission success.

Lastly, AI is helping us to analyze data from space missions. Space missions generate huge amounts of data, and it can be challenging to analyze it all. With AI, we can analyze this data more efficiently and accurately, which helps us to make better decisions and gain new insights.

In conclusion, AI is transforming space exploration in many ways, from predicting space weather to finding exoplanets to controlling spacecraft. As we continue to explore the universe, AI will undoubtedly play an important role in helping us to make new discoveries and push the boundaries of what’s possible.
